You’ll be fishing on one of the two 21’ custom built aluminum boats that can accommodate up to 4 guests each. The boats are powered by single 50 HP Yamaha engines and reach a maximum speed of 30 knots. The vessels are also wheelchair accessible.
All trips are available from mid May until the end of October and you can choose from half-day and full-day trip options. These trips are shared, which means you’ll be charged by person, not for the whole boat. Options to book private boats can be discussed, but come wth an upgrade fee.
You’ll primarily drift fish and back troll for a variety of fish species, such as Steelhead, Dolly Varden, Arctic Char, and different types of Salmon. Captain Alex covers all fishing equipment and even caters to fly fishermen. Rainbow Trout, Dolly Varden, and Steelhead have to be released, but you get to keep other species.
Feel free to bring any food and drinks you prefer and don’t forget to purchase a fishing license.
